java
文章平均质量分 64
Kiven.Jeffrey
天行健,君子以自强不息!
展开
-
Win10搭建Jenkins部署Java项目(本机和远程Win10部署)
文章目录一、前言&背景二、环境准备三、插件安装四、全局配置MavenJDKGitMaven五、新建项目并配置新建项目配置1、Discard old builds2、This project is parameterized添加操作选项,打包或者回滚历史版本jenkins-test是我的分支名3、Git4、构建5、构建后操作*、打包完成生成tag用于版本回滚**、打包完成后通过ssh将jar包推送到另一台win10六、打包七、部分参考博客一、前言&背景1、项目原因需要在windows系统搭原创 2022-05-02 14:16:40 · 4218 阅读 · 2 评论 -
Java使用 Thumbnails 压缩图片
业务:用户上传一张图片到文件站,需要返回原图url和缩略图url处理思路: 因为上传图片方法返回url是单个上传,第一步先上传原图并返回url 处理缩略图并上传:拿到MultipartFile压缩成缩略图后存放到项目内指定文件夹 用项目内新生成的缩略图转换为MultipartFile发送给图片上传方法得到url 流程处理完后删除存放在项目内的缩略图 public void imageMethod(MultipartFile file){原创 2020-06-04 15:55:21 · 1894 阅读 · 0 评论 -
java List 构建树状结构
一、SQLSELECT categoryCode AS 'id', categoryName AS 'label', parentCode AS 'parentId'FROM a二、JAVA代码/** * 创建树形结构菜单列表 * * @param menus * @return */ p...原创 2019-09-20 15:15:01 · 1075 阅读 · 0 评论 -
Java语言打印心型
一、今天闲来无事找了两个打印心形的java代码(撩妹可用哦)—————————————————————第一种————————————————————————public static void main(String[] args) { System.out.println(callBack("*")); } public static String callBack(St...原创 2018-10-28 22:27:58 · 14301 阅读 · 4 评论 -
Hibernate和Mybatis的对比
Hibernate和Mybatis的对比第一方面:开发速度的对比就开发速度而言,Hibernate的真正掌握要比Mybatis来得难些。Mybatis框架相对简单很容易上手,但也相对简陋些。个人觉得要用好Mybatis还是首先要先理解好Hibernate。比起两者的开发速度,不仅仅要考虑到两者的特性及性能,更要根据项目需求去考虑究竟哪一个更适合项目开发,比如:一个项目中用到的复杂查询基...原创 2018-12-14 10:27:58 · 111 阅读 · 0 评论 -
java算法排序之冒泡排序
1.比较两个相邻的元素,将值大的元素交换至右端。2.依次比较相邻的两个数,将小数放在前面,大数放在后面。即在第一趟:首先比较第1个和第2个数,将小数放前,大数放后。然后比较第2个数和第3个数,将小数放前,大数放后,如此继续,直至比较最后两个数,将小数放前,大数放后。重复第一趟步骤,直至全部排序完成。3.第一趟比较完成后,最后一个数一定是数组中最大的一个数,所以第二趟比较的时候最后一个数不参...原创 2019-02-18 16:21:45 · 135 阅读 · 0 评论 -
java判断当前时间在某个时间段内
public class test4 { public static void main(String[] args) { SimpleDateFormat df = new SimpleDateFormat("HH:mm");// 设置日期格式 Date now = null; Date beginTime = null; Date endTime = null; try...原创 2019-02-18 17:37:00 · 25403 阅读 · 6 评论